Body

Origins and Family

Anne Blanchard was born in Montpellier[2]. She was born on May 3, 1921[3]. Her father was Marcel Blanchard[8].

Education

Anne Blanchard was educated at Paris-Sorbonne University - Paris IV[11]. She earned the academic degree of Doctor of Arts[22].

Career and Affiliations

Recorded occupations include historian[6] and professeur des universités[7]. Anne Blanchard was employed by Paul-Valéry University (Montpellier, 1970-2024)[10]. Doctoral students include Dominique Biloghi[19], a historian[27], b. 1955[28], of France[29], specialised in history[30] and Élie Pélaquier[20], a historian[31], b. 1946[32], of France[33].

Works and Contributions

A notable work attributed to Anne Blanchard is Q110819079[12].

Recognition

Awards received include Prix Thérouanne[13], a literary award[34], in France[35], founded in 1869[36] and Prix du Maréchal-Foch[14], a literary award[37], in France[38], founded in 1955[39].

Death and Burial

Anne Blanchard died on June 29, 1998[5]. She passed away in Montpellier[4].
